Vérification de Paiement
Ici vous aurez la documentation pour vérifier l'etat d'une transaction après une opération
REQUEST BODY SCHEMA : "Application/json"
POST
https://api.ego-pay.net/api/v1/payments/gate/verify
Vérifier le statut d'une demande de débit.
Une clé API est requise pour commencer. Votre clé API ou Token est generé dans votre Tableau de bord.
Les requêtes sont authentifiées avec une clé API ( token ).
Request Body
token*
String
Token généré
transaction_ref*
String
Reference unique de la transaction ( génerer par le marchand )
Response outputs detail
details
Encapsule des informations détaillées sur l'opération
transaction_ref
Identiant unique de la transaction du marchand
payment_reference
Réference unique de la transaction géneré par eGoPAY
amount
Montant de la transaction
channel
Cannal utilisé par le client lors du paiement. * Peut être Null si l'operation de paiment n'a pas réussi
channel_trxRef
Réference unique de paiement générée par l'opérateur. * Peut être Null si l'operation de paiment n'a pas réussi
status
Le code status de l'etat de paiement. - 1 => Paiement est effectué à succès - 2 => Paiement en cours de validation - 0 ou 4 => Paiement echoué
phone_number
Numéro de téléphone du client au format international
payment_made_at
Date et heure de l'opération
Response codes detail
Vous pouvez utiliser ces informations pour diagnostiquer les requetes ayant échoués et affiner vos capacités de gestion des exceptions.
500
An error occurred while processing the request. Please check your auth token
500
Transaction already exists with the same transaction_id.
408
Amount must be an integer
408
Payment channel must be in 'ALL'
408
MINIMUM_FIELDS_REQUIRED
410
Minium required amount is 200 FCFA
Last updated